Transaction 76618c21bcf1f539fb785ced31dfc6fd7c520e3b7d13eca75617ecd6d30fdba1
1 Input
1 Output
-
76618c21bcf1f539fb785ced31dfc6fd7c520e3b7d13eca75617ecd6d30fdba1:0
- value
- 198008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 383dc70826645a068581572e28cc0282efe45ede OP_EQUAL
- address
- 36pPmfETzPcVcYg7ZpJbHya8FvQpShqUXc